Soon after the death of Humayun, the Hindu King Hemu occupied Delhi and Agra. The second battle of Panipat was fought between Samrat Hemchandra Vikramaditya also known as Hemu and the Mughal army of Akbar at Panipat, Haryana, India on 5 Nov 1556. Akbar was only 13 years old at that time. Akbar's general defeated Hemu and the Mughal Empire was re-established.
